Practical Considerations for Holiday Product Creation

Success with a digital embroidery file like Floral S in a busy season depends on smart application. Its intricate floral details demand attention in a few areas.

You should use this design carefully on items with very small hoop sizes, as the tiny lettering and layered botanical elements might lose definition if scaled down too much. Similarly, stitching on thick towels or dense fabrics requires confirming the stitch density is adequate to prevent puckering and to ensure the details remain crisp. For popular holiday items like dark fabric sweatshirts or stretchy garments, planning is key. Always test your thread colors on both light and dark fabric to ensure the chosen palette pops appropriately. Using proper stabilizer is non-negotiable for these applications.

Items that need repeated washing, like kitchen towels or aprons, are great candidates, but review the small details after your first test stitch to ensure they are robust. Creating realistic mockups for your Etsy listings helps customer trust, as they can visualize the final product accurately. Finally, a crucial step for any small shop product: always confirm the commercial licensing terms of the digital embroidery file before selling finished seasonal products to avoid any legal issues.
